I've got an idea for the competition to create the hardest level. :twisted: There will be more than enough hard levels, as Small World II has shown. :x
The rules:
1. The size is not limited, but please don't make it TOO large, cause most people won't play levels with a size of a football field (and you get less points)
2. NO GLITCHES except as a pure decoration. (If you want glitches, you may make an another competition idea of a most glitchy level. :lol: )
3. No hex-editing, cause it will be unstable on a lot of systems.
4. That's all.

About other things (like scoring, etc...) I'm uncertain...

Actually, a suggestion (but feel free to ignore): I know that some people find a lot of the custom levels nowadays too hard (look at also the feedback for the Small World II competition... many people didn't manage to complete all of the levels for judging, you might get similar feedback for a "Hard Levels" competition).

So how about this suggestion: Make the funnest level that would also be considered "easy" by most. The challenge would be to create a level that really only contains basic/standard puzzle types as to not create any headaches, but use them in a way that makes the level the freshest and funnest of the bunch. I think this would actually be an interesting challenge for level creators: to come up with ways to make the level fun and new and interesting, without simply increasing the difficulty level. The way the level flows, the visuals, replayability, etc could all be factors.

I don't want to hijack this thread from Muzozavr, but what do you folks think of that idea? I could even be made into an official compo (i.e. with prizes).
